WorldsPlayer the Worlds.com is a 3D chat environment where users can enter different virtual worlds.

Despite not being considered a game, users create an avatar online and navigate immersive environments while communicating and interacting with other users.

Worlds.com: chat room style virtual worlds

Launched in 1995, before Second Life, Worlds was the first environment of “chat” three-dimensional where a large number of users can simultaneously log in without being locked out.

In this community, also called “red social”, users can teleport to various virtual worlds and communicate with other visitors. They can also create their own 3D worlds and unique avatars.

After downloading and installing WorldsPlayer on your PC, You must provide an email where they will send you a Link to register. Once your user name and password, may Choose from more than 100 humans, animals (penguins, kangaroos), different characters and monsters.

Hidden virtual worlds at Worlds.com

Worlds.com presents a graphic window that represents a 3D environment and a text sale (chat). Users move within these gloomy rooms in digital bodies known as avatars..

There is a wide range of avatars. There are the flat 2D avatars that are mere images that change depending on the angle at which they are viewed, plus 3D articulated avatars that can perform a range of movements and actions. 2D avatars are provided free of charge to all members of the world, but wacky and creepy 3D avatars are for paid members only (VIP members). Every new user gets 10 free VIP days when you sign up.

WorldsPlayer y WorldsShaper

WorldsPlayer It is a powerful set of tools to create and visualize virtual environments Multi -user and 3D.

These “virtual worlds” are complex and richly textured three-dimensional spaces that come to life with both programmed behaviors and the virtual presence of user avatars who share the experience and communicate in real time..

WorldsPlayer consists of three main components:

  • WorldsPlayer. The 3D like of a web browser: is the window that allows you to see a virtual world, constantly updating the screen display so any changes are immediately visible. WorldsPlayer resides on every client PC, along with the files that define a virtual world. If the files do not exist locally, can be downloaded over the network and cached or written locally.
  • WorldsShaper. WorldsShaper is a set of tools for creating virtual environments. It enables you to build architectural structures, add textures to them and integrate actions that happen in these spaces. When you save a world, WorldsShaper creates a .WORLD file. These .WORLD files (and related content files) are the files that will be placed or downloaded on each client PC and that WorldsPlayer will play. WorldsShaper is not required for end users to view a virtual world. End users install versions “external” from WorldsPlayer that do not include WorldsShaper.
  • Servers. The server handles all the details of multi-user interactivity, constantly updating the chat text, avatar positions and other status information shared over the network. Multiple servers can be used to spread the load in very large or busy environments. A separate optional user server handles authentication, user tracking and database interactivity.

System requirements

  • Processor: Pentium 400MHz or faster
  • Operating system: Windows 98 a Windows 10
  • Free hard disk space: 100 MB
  • Java 6 (the installer already includes a private copy of Java)
  • Internet connection.
